I'd like to see us win this, not that I care much about the competition in question, but a run of one win in four games would be all too familiar and similar to what happened last season.

2007/8

11/08-29/09 : P11 W7 D4 L0 - unbeaten start to the season
03/10-24/10 : P4 W1 D1 L2 - one win in four games
28/10-02/12 : P8 W6 D2 L0 - unbeaten in eight games
08/12-19/12 : P4 W1 D0 L3 - one win in four games
22/12-26/01 : P9 W4 D5 L0 - unbeaten in nine games
30/01-16/02 : P4 W1 D1 L2 - one win in four games
19/02-15/03 : P7 W7 D0 L0 - won seven in a row

then the unbeaten runs stopped being split by one win in four, just two defeats in the last 12 games including one run of eight unbeaten.

Yes, this season looks very different because we've won more games and not drawn as many. But we still can't afford to slip into poor form and we need to keep winning.
